Quad City Promise Scholarship
The $2,000 Quad City Promise Scholarship is for up to 50 local high school graduates and transfer students who apply for admission and are admitted to Augustana College.
Dr. Kivisto to get honorary degree, link to family
Augustana's Dr.Peter Kivisto has a couple of firsts awaiting him in the next few weeks: He will receive an honorary doctorate from the University of Turku in Finland, and he will step into the childhood home of his Finnish grandfather.
